Seychelles has launched construction of its first utility-scale floating solar power plant, a 5. 8MW project in the Providence Lagoon on Mahé Island. It is expected to play a pivotal role in meeting the country's renewable energy targets. Solar panels work by harnessing sunlight and converting it into electricity, a process made possible by the photovoltaic effect. . At a high level, solar panels are made up of solar cells, which absorb sunlight. These electrons flow through a circuit and produce direct current. . Solar panels are the most important part of a solar power system since they produce the electricity that eventually finds it's way to your laptop, lights and television. In this basic introduction, we look at how this happens. The word “photovoltaic” means electricity from light, which precisely describes the job of these panels. But how do they make this conversion happen? Let's explore the process.
